Home
last modified time | relevance | path

Searched refs:splitPairRule (Results 1 – 14 of 14) sorted by relevance

/cts/tests/framework/base/windowmanager/jetpack/src/android/server/wm/jetpack/embedding/
DActivityEmbeddingLifecycleTests.java79 SplitPairRule splitPairRule = createWildcardSplitPairRuleWithPrimaryActivityClass( in testSecondaryActivityLaunch_replacing() local
81 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SecondaryActivityLaunch_replacing()
85 splitPairRule, "secondaryActivity1" /* secondActivityId */, mSplitInfoConsumer); in testSecondaryActivityLaunch_replacing()
96 TestActivityWithId2.class, splitPairRule, in testSecondaryActivityLaunch_replacing()
120 SplitPairRule splitPairRule = createWildcardSplitPairRuleWithPrimaryActivityClass( in testSecondaryActivityLaunch_nonReplacing() local
122 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SecondaryActivityLaunch_nonReplacing()
126 TestActivityWithId.class, splitPairRule, in testSecondaryActivityLaunch_nonReplacing()
138 TestActivityWithId2.class, splitPairRule, in testSecondaryActivityLaunch_nonReplacing()
160 SplitPairRule splitPairRule = createWildcardSplitPairRuleWithPrimaryActivityClass( in testSecondaryActivityLaunch_multiSplit() local
162 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SecondaryActivityLaunch_multiSplit()
[all …]
DActivityEmbeddingBoundsTests.java88 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testParentWindowMetricsPredicate() local
94 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testParentWindowMetricsPredicate()
99 primaryActivity, TestActivityWithId.class, splitPairRule, secondaryActivityId, in testParentWindowMetricsPredicate()
118 assertValidSplit(primaryActivity, secondaryActivity, splitPairRule); in testParentWindowMetricsPredicate()
132 final SplitPairRule splitPairRule = createUnevenWidthSplitPairRule( in testLayoutDirection_LeftToRight() local
134 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testLayoutDirection_LeftToRight()
141 splitPairRule, "secondaryActivityId", mSplitInfoConsumer); in testLayoutDirection_LeftToRight()
154 final SplitPairRule splitPairRule = createUnevenWidthSplitPairRule( in testLayoutDirection_RightToLeft() local
156 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testLayoutDirection_RightToLeft()
163 splitPairRule, "secondaryActivityId", mSplitInfoConsumer); in testLayoutDirection_RightToLeft()
[all …]
DActivityEmbeddingLaunchTests.java81 SplitPairRule splitPairRule = new SplitPairRule.Builder( in testSplitWithPrimaryActivity() local
85 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SplitWithPrimaryActivity()
95 TestActivityWithId.class, splitPairRule, in testSplitWithPrimaryActivity()
120 assertValidSplit(primaryActivity, newSecondaryActivity, splitPairRule); in testSplitWithPrimaryActivity()
134 SplitPairRule splitPairRule = createWildcardSplitPairRule(true /* shouldClearTop */); in testPrimaryActivityLaunchToSideClearTop() local
135 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testPrimaryActivityLaunchToSideClearTop()
138 TestActivityWithId.class, splitPairRule, in testPrimaryActivityLaunchToSideClearTop()
149 TestActivityWithId.class, splitPairRule, in testPrimaryActivityLaunchToSideClearTop()
172 S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testSplitWithTopmostActivity() local
173 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SplitWithTopmostActivity()
[all …]
DActivityEmbeddingCrossUidTests.java111 final SplitPairRule splitPairRule = new SplitPairRule.Builder( in testCrossUidActivityEmbeddingIsNotAllowed() local
115 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testCrossUidActivityEmbeddingIsNotAllowed()
139 final SplitPairRule splitPairRule = new SplitPairRule.Builder( in testCrossUidActivityEmbeddingIsNotAllowedWithoutPermission() local
143 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testCrossUidActivityEmbeddingIsNotAllowedWithoutPermission()
184 final SplitPairRule splitPairRule = new SplitPairRule.Builder( in testUntrustedCrossUidActivityEmbeddingIsAllowedWithOptIn() local
188 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testUntrustedCrossUidActivityEmbeddingIsAllowedWithOptIn()
193 splitPairRule, mSplitInfoConsumer, "id", true /* verify */); in testUntrustedCrossUidActivityEmbeddingIsAllowedWithOptIn()
211 final SplitPairRule splitPairRule = new SplitPairRule.Builder( in testUntrustedCrossUidActivityEmbedding_notAllowedForNonEmbeddable() local
215 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testUntrustedCrossUidActivityEmbedding_notAllowedForNonEmbeddable()
219 splitPairRule, mSplitInfoConsumer, "id", true /* verify */); in testUntrustedCrossUidActivityEmbedding_notAllowedForNonEmbeddable()
[all …]
DSplitAttributesCalculatorTest.java81 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testSetAndClearSplitAttributesCalculator() local
90 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SetAndClearSplitAttributesCalculator()
96 startActivityAndVerifySplitAttributes(activityA, TestActivityWithId.class, splitPairRule, in testSetAndClearSplitAttributesCalculator()
131 splitPairRule, activityDId, 1, /* expectedCallbackCount */ in testSetAndClearSplitAttributesCalculator()
176 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testSplitAttributesCustomizationByCalculator() local
185 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SplitAttributesCustomizationByCalculator()
208 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testSplitAttributesCalculatorInvocation_screenRotation() local
217 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testSplitAttributesCalculatorInvocation_screenRotation()
223 startActivityAndVerifySplitAttributes(activityA, TestActivityWithId.class, splitPairRule, in testSplitAttributesCalculatorInvocation_screenRotation()
259 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testSplitAttributesCalculatorInvocation_pip() local
[all …]
DActivityEmbeddingFinishTests.java72 S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testFinishPrimary() local
73 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testFinishPrimary()
78 primaryActivity, TestActivityWithId.class, splitPairRule, "secondaryActivity", in testFinishPrimary()
97 S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testFinishSecondary() local
98 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testFinishSecondary()
103 primaryActivity, TestActivityWithId.class, splitPairRule, "secondaryActivity", in testFinishSecondary()
349 final SplitPairRule splitPairRule = splitPairRuleBuilder.build(); in start() local
350 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in start()
360 primaryActivity, TestActivityWithId.class, splitPairRule, in start()
DEmbeddedActivityWindowInfoTests.java106 final S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testGetEmbeddedActivityWindowInfo_embeddedActivity() local
107 mActivityEmbeddingComponent.setEmbeddingRules(Sets.newHashSet(splitPairRule)); in testGetEmbeddedActivityWindowInfo_embeddedActivity()
113 TestActivityWithId2.class, splitPairRule, in testGetEmbeddedActivityWindowInfo_embeddedActivity()
144 final S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testEmbeddedActivityWindowInfoCallback() local
145 mActivityEmbeddingComponent.setEmbeddingRules(Sets.newHashSet(splitPairRule)); in testEmbeddedActivityWindowInfoCallback()
161 TestActivityWithId2.class, splitPairRule, in testEmbeddedActivityWindowInfoCallback()
199 TestActivityWithId2.class, splitPairRule, in testEmbeddedActivityWindowInfoCallback()
DSplitAttributesRuntimeApisTests.java93 S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testInvalidateTopVisibleSplitAttributes() local
102 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testInvalidateTopVisibleSplitAttributes()
144 S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testUpdateSplitAttributes() local
152 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testUpdateSplitAttributes()
159 TestActivityWithId.class, splitPairRule, ACTIVITY_B_ID, mSplitInfoConsumer); in testUpdateSplitAttributes()
DActivityStackApisTests.java64 S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testFinishActivityStacks_finishPrimary() local
65 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testFinishActivityStacks_finishPrimary()
70 TestActivityWithId.class, splitPairRule, "secondaryActivity", mSplitInfoConsumer); in testFinishActivityStacks_finishPrimary()
88 SplitPairRule splitPairRule = createWildcardSplitPairRule(); in testFinishActivityStacks_finishSecondary() local
89 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testFinishActivityStacks_finishSecondary()
94 TestActivityWithId.class, splitPairRule, "secondaryActivity", mSplitInfoConsumer); in testFinishActivityStacks_finishSecondary()
DActivityEmbeddingIntegrationTests.java93 S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testDisplayFeaturesWithEmbedding() local
100 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testDisplayFeaturesWithEmbedding()
103 TestActivityWithId.class, splitPairRule, in testDisplayFeaturesWithEmbedding()
134 SplitPairRule splitPairRule = createSplitPairRuleBuilder( in testClearSplitInfoCallback() local
141 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testClearSplitInfoCallback()
DActivityEmbeddingFocusTests.java170 final SplitPairRule splitPairRule = createSplitPairRuleBuilder( in setupActivities() local
178 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in setupActivities()
DActivityEmbeddingPolicyTests.java122 SplitPairRule splitPairRule = createWildcardSplitPairRule(true /* shouldClearTop */); in testInputDuringAnimationIsNotAllowed_untrustedEmbedding() local
123 mActivityEmbe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in testInputDuringAnimationIsNotAllowed_untrustedEmbedding()
/cts/tests/framework/base/windowmanager/jetpack/SignedApp/src/android/server/wm/jetpack/signed/
DSignedEmbeddingActivity.java85 SplitPairRule splitPairRule = createSplitPairRuleBuilder( in startActivityInSplit() local
92 embeddingComponent.setEmbeddingRules(Collections.singleton(splitPairRule)); in startActivityInSplit()
99 splitPairRule, splitInfoConsumer, EMBEDDED_ACTIVITY_ID, false /* verify */); in startActivityInSplit()
/cts/tests/framework/base/windowmanager/jetpack/src/android/server/wm/jetpack/utils/
DActivityEmbeddingUtil.java230 @NonNull SplitPairRule splitPairRule, @NonNull String secondActivityId, in startActivityAndVerifySplitAttributes() argument
233 secondActivityClass, splitPairRule, secondActivityId, 1 /* expectedCallbackCount */, in startActivityAndVerifySplitAttributes()
242 @NonNull ComponentName secondActivityComponent, @NonNull SplitPairRule splitPairRule, in startActivityCrossUidInSplit() argument
271 splitPairRule); in startActivityCrossUidInSplit()